The Stanwell House Hotel: A Luxurious Haven in Lymington

For discerning travelers seeking a blend of historic charm and modern comfort, the Stanwell House Hotel in Lymington presents an exceptional choice. Located at 14-15 High St, Lymington SO41 9AA, United Kingdom, this esteemed establishment offers a truly memorable experience. The hotel boasts a rich heritage, having been meticulously restored to retain its original character while incorporating contemporary amenities. It's a destination that effortlessly combines the best of both worlds, appealing to a broad range of guests, from families and couples to business travelers.

I have been here now three times within one month and that says it all really. Twice for a cream tea and once for lunch. ||If it had not been recommended, I probably would have walked past the establishment. ||Once inside you are greeted by genuinely friendly and attentive staff. We booked tables on the first two occasions but you can simply turn up if you so wish. You can either sit in the restaurant, the orangery, or outside where there is an extensive patio/garden area - perfect on a warm, summer day. The restaurant/orangery has an upmarket feel about it but you can dress casually. ||The wait for drinks/food is reasonable and is all very well presented. The pricing is reasonable too. ||With regard to the cream teas we had, the scones were warm and fresh, the jams tasted homemade and the cream was the proper clotted variety. The tea (which ever type you choose) was loose leaf and you are provided with individual strainers. We were also provided with proper napkins and not the usual paper serviettes. ||When visiting for lunch, we had fish and chips. The fish was huge and the batter coating was lovely and crunchy. The chips were perfectly cooked and this came with half a lemon, tartare sauce, fresh mushy peas. Again, all nicely presented. ||The toilet facilities are exceptionally clean and had a luxurious feel along with nice hand soap and hand cream etc. ||I am definitely looking forward to returning for the evening menu. ||Give it a go and see for yourself - you won’t be disappointed!

Our second stay at Stanwell. Beautiful top floor large room,road facing, with separate sofa seating area, two tvs, well appointed and elegant bathroom. Bed a little hard but it was so hot that we slept on top of the duvet. Fan provided in room. Housekeeping top notch. Everything spotless. Really liked this room. ||Used room service. Really very good sharing platter arrived. Garden very well maintained with the garden bar open, plenty of shady seating and also the pizza oven providing tasty food. Nice relaxed place to enjoy a drink. Maybe less frenetic music considering the general more mature age of clientele. Overall service was really good and efficient here. ||Breakfast was tasty, hot and good. Breakfast service on the first two mornings of our three night stay was not good at all though. On both days we were not asked if we wanted drinks or toast as we sat down. We were not offered sauces, no one came to clear the quite small table as it became cluttered with used plates. We had to ask for everything, orange juice repeatedly ran out and it was clear that the staff on duty on these two days were not on the ball or not trained well. Day three; the staff (different girls) were the polar opposite, asked us what drinks we would like, offered toast and sauces and came to see if everything was good, cleared the table etc. All on point. Needs to be consistent, especially for the price point of the room. ||A customers dog was creating a lot of noise in the hotel but it was dealt with swiftly and decisively. We appreciated that. ||Standout service from Phoebe at reception who could not be more helpful or kind and also the lovely tall man who does housekeeping for helping us with cases when we left. Porters on arrival would be good when lots of stairs are involved. ||Marked down because breakfast service was really not good but overall we had a lovely time at our favourite hotel in the area.
